N86 GPS issues

Hi,

 

Posted this seperately from the N97 GPS issues but I'm having similar issues with my N86, namely speed regularly drops to 0, the route is repeatedly recalculated for no obvious reason, the map constantly rotates its orientation (just like being on a waltzer) and my location shifts off road by "some considerable margin" before settling down.

 

I've also noticed that I often can't get a GPS lock without switching the phone off and back on again after a few seconds. I always gets a fix within 5-10 seconds after a reboot.

 

I always have the e-mail client in the background but no other apps running.

 

Has anyone else, apart from the N97 owners (you know who you are) experienced these issues.

 

I'm running N86-1 on Orange with 10.086 with Maps v3.0.09wk18b01 and map version 0.1.22.103

I have the same problem, the phone is now on it's second trip for repair.  I "upgraded" from a N82, with a working GPS.

When I compare my old N82 with the N86, I can se that the N86 drops all connection to the GPS satellites every second minute. (I use the built in program GPS data, looking at satellite data on both devices at the same time, my old N82 stays connected, but the N86 has to recalculate after it has lost the connection every second minute)

 

This is a real problem for me, I use Nokia Sportstracker to record all my training, and with the N86 I get some rather odd recordings, due to this constant recalculating of the current position. A training (verified) trip for 5 kilometers on N82 can be more than 6 km on N86. This of course gives me a good average speed, but I prefer to record the correct one...

 

I am now waiting for the return after the second repair period of 4 weeks, maybe they can fix it, otherwise I'll have to buy something that works.

Nokia released a software update v20.115. It isn't available on the website, it must be done through the mobile.

 

1.Click on applications. 

2.Click SW Update.

3.You will find one update click on(mark the check box).

4.Then install. 

 

It worked fro me. But another problem came up, when i click tools setting and choose Navigation the  OVI maps software restarts.
